Senior Program Analyst

The Office of Professional Competence (OPC) is seeking a Senior Program Analyst to join their team in the San Francisco or Los Angeles office. The annual salary for this role is $104,308 - $139,079. This position has a once per month in-office requirement. This role will provide research assistance to attorneys on issues related to professional responsibility including conflicts of interest, confidentiality, and the unauthorized practice of law. The ideal candidate will have strong writing skills, along with effective customer service and/or call center experience. A Juris Doctor, paralegal certification, or completion of coursework in attorney professional responsibility is preferred but not required.

The Office of Professional Competence (OPC) helps California attorneys practice law ethically. OPC develops and maintains resources that facilitate compliance with ethical duties. The office administers a telephone call center called the Ethics Hotline and conducts preventative education and outreach. The office also supports key committees and working groups that provide ethics guidance and address policy and rule changes to support evolving changes in the ethical rules, certifies Lawyer Referral Services, and oversees the Lawyer Assistance Program (Support).

The Senior Program Analyst staffs the Ethics Hotline, a call center that provides research assistance to attorneys on issues related to professional responsibility, including conflicts of interest, advertising, confidentiality, and the unauthorized practice of law.

Additional responsibilities may include supporting the administration of the State Bar's Lawyer Referral Service program; conducting in-depth legal and factual research on complex issues; assisting in the development of educational materials and legal resources for California licensees; and maintaining and updating ethics-related content on the State Bar's website. The role also involves drafting legal memoranda, briefs, advisory opinions, and committee agenda materials; analyzing legislation, case law, and other legal authorities; and performing cite-checking and proofreading of legal documents.

Under general direction, the Senior Program Analyst conducts professional-level analysis and administers programs and/or functions; performs specialty assignments and acts in a lead capacity with respect to lower-level professional and support staff; and performs related work as required.

The Senior Program Analyst is the lead/advanced journey-level professional class performing advanced, specialized work of a professional nature, utilizing skills that require technical expertise and an understanding of complex analytical procedures and program processes. Incumbents exercise a high degree of professional judgment with considerable independence. This class may function as the lead over professional, technical, and/or administrative support personnel on an ongoing or project basis. Responsibilities include project planning and the performance of high-level professional analyses and services in the division/unit to which they are assigned.

Duties may include, but are not limited to the following:

  • Provides expertise and guidance to other professional, and/or administrative staff in complex program analysis and solutions.
  • Performs advanced research, conducts studies to determine needs, prepares reports, and recommends implementation procedures for a variety of program needs.
  • Serves as a primary communication liaison with State Bar committees, members, financial institutions, vendors, contractors, general public, other departments and employees.
  • Evaluates existing and alternative policies and makes recommendations toward establishment of revised policies and procedures.
  • Performs advanced professional work in support of State Bar programs and services involving the knowledge, interpretation, and application of State Bar policies, rules, regulations, and procedures.
  • Reviews processes and maintains program transactions, records and other documents; assists in the preparation and maintenance of statistical data, reports, correspondence, special studies, and conducts research.
  • Provides input in developing and evaluating program policies and procedures and evaluates and proposes changes concerning the methods of operation.
  • Provides lead direction over programs, staff, or special projects, which involves assigning, reviewing, and coordinating staff work.
  • Trains staff in program policies, rules, regulations, and procedures; assesses workloads; assigns employees as necessary to ensure the proper level of support for ongoing activities of the department.
  • Assists with the selection, training, direction, and evaluation of staff.
  • Implements guidelines to ensure adherence to the State Bar rules and regulations governing the administration of State Bar programs, services, and membership.
  • Represents the State Bar at programs and functions and responds to inquiries from board members, management, attorneys, and the public.
  • May perform a number of other similar or related duties which may not be specifically included within this position description, but which are consistent with the general level of the job.

Education:

  • Bachelor's degree in a field that develops skills related to essential duties, or a combination of education and experience sufficient to perform the duties of the position.

Experience:

  • Minimum of three (3) years of journey-level professional experience in data collection and evaluation, research or performance or financial analysis, or grant compliance in a public sector, legal or nonprofit environment, or equivalent.

License, Certificate, Registration Requirements:

  • None required.
